Originally released in 1933. The Vanishing Frontier is a western film. directed by Phil Rosen. At just 65 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.

Starring Johnny Mack Brown, Evalyn Knapp, and Zasu Pitts

Synopsis

Its 1850 and California is under ruthless military rule. Kirby Tornell's rancho has been taken over by soldiers and when two of Kirby's men are captured, he goes there to free them. He meets the General's daughter there and attracted to her, repeatedly returns to see her. Eventually he is captured and now his men must try and rescue him.
